LogoSTP 查看器文档

材质指南 - 高级材质管理与可视化

STP 查看器中材质管理的完整指南,包括材质分析、可视化控制和移动端优化工作流程

材质指南

概述

STP 查看器的材质管理系统提供了用于分析、可视化和控制 3D 模型中材质的综合工具。此高级功能帮助您理解材质属性、隔离特定组件并优化技术分析工作流程。

材质分析

检查颜色、透明度和物理属性

视觉控制

显示、隐藏和隔离材质以进行专注分析

移动端优化

响应式设计的触控友好界面

搜索和筛选

通过智能搜索快速查找材质

访问材质面板

前提条件

  • 加载包含多个材质的 3D 模型
  • 点击全屏图标 (⛶) 进入全屏模式
  • 材质面板仅在全屏模式下可用

桌面端访问

打开材质面板

点击全屏工具栏中的Material按钮 (🎨)

面板布局

材质面板作为分割视图布局的覆盖层打开:

  • 左侧: 带搜索功能的材质列表
  • 右侧: 详细的材质属性

移动端访问

打开更多菜单

在全屏模式下,点击工具栏中的More按钮 (⋯)

选择材质

从下拉菜单中点击Material

全屏面板

材质面板作为针对触控交互优化的全屏覆盖层打开

响应式设计: 界面根据屏幕尺寸在桌面对话框和移动端抽屉布局之间自动适配。

材质列表界面

理解材质显示

列表中的每个材质显示:

视觉指示器

  • 颜色点: 大圆形颜色预览(直径 6px)
  • 透明度徽章: 透明材质的蓝色点指示器
  • 选择指示器: 蓝色点显示当前选中的材质

材质信息

  • 材质名称: 自动生成或从 CAD 文件导入
  • 类型徽章: 材质类型(Phong、Physical 等)
  • 颜色代码: 大写十六进制颜色值
  • 透明度: 透明材质的不透明度百分比
  • 使用计数: 使用此材质的网格数量

材质类型说明

类型描述属性
Phong基本着色模型颜色、不透明度
Physical基于物理的渲染颜色、不透明度、金属度、粗糙度

材质识别: 具有透明度的材质会同时显示不透明度百分比和蓝色指示器点,便于快速识别。

搜索和筛选

智能搜索功能

  • 实时筛选: 输入时结果即时更新
  • 不区分大小写: 搜索不受大小写影响
  • 基于名称: 通过材质名称搜索
  • 清除功能: 一键重置搜索

搜索界面

  • 搜索图标: 放大镜指示器
  • 清除按钮: 输入时出现 X 按钮
  • 结果计数器: 搜索期间显示"Y 个中的 X 个结果"
  • 总计数: 显示模型中找到的材质总数

材质属性分析

基本信息

选择材质时,详细信息面板显示:

核心属性

  • 名称: 材质标识符
  • 类型: 带彩色徽章的着色模型类型
  • 索引: 内部材质参考编号

外观属性

  • 颜色: 带十六进制代码和色样的 RGB 值
  • 不透明度: 带透明度指示器的百分比值
  • 金属度: 金属般外观(仅限 Physical 材质)
  • 粗糙度: 表面粗糙度(仅限 Physical 材质)

使用统计

  • 网格数量: 使用此材质的几何网格数
  • 使用徽章: 显示利用率的视觉指示器

Physical 与 Phong 对比: Physical 材质显示额外的金属度和粗糙度属性以实现逼真渲染。

材质操作

视图控制功能

适配视图

  • 目的: 自动框架显示使用所选材质的所有网格
  • 使用方法: 点击带焦点图标的"适配视图"按钮
  • 结果: 相机调整以最佳显示材质几何体

切换可见性

  • 目的: 显示或隐藏使用所选材质的所有网格
  • 使用方法: 点击带眼睛图标的"切换可见性"按钮
  • 结果: 材质在 3D 视图中变为不可见/可见

隔离材质

  • 目的: 隐藏所有其他材质,仅显示选中的材质
  • 使用方法: 点击带 EyeOff 图标的"隔离材质"按钮
  • 结果: 仅选中的材质保持可见以进行专注分析

隔离模式: 隔离材质时,使用模型树中的"显示全部"来恢复完整可见性。

移动端专用功能

触控优化

大触控目标

  • 材质项目: 便于选择的最小 48px 高度
  • 操作按钮: 最小 44px 触控区域
  • 颜色点: 24px 可点击区域
  • 间距: 适当间隙防止意外触摸

手势支持

  • 点击选择: 单击选择材质
  • 滚动浏览: 材质列表的平滑滚动
  • 滑动关闭: 向下滑动关闭面板
  • 捏合缩放: 颜色预览支持缩放手势

移动端界面布局

抽屉设计

  • 滑动面板: 从屏幕底部出现
  • 手柄指示器: 便于关闭的拖动手柄
  • 自动调整大小: 适应屏幕方向
  • 安全区域: 考虑设备刘海和主页指示器

响应式行为

  • 纵向模式: 堆叠部分的垂直布局
  • 横向模式: 空间允许时的水平布局
  • 平板模式: 大屏幕上的对话框界面
  • 方向切换: 布局间的无缝过渡

专业工作流程

材质分析工作流程

调研材质

打开材质面板并检查模型中所有可用的材质

识别关键材质

使用搜索查找特定材质或具有特定属性的材质

分析属性

选择每个材质以检查颜色、透明度和物理属性

视觉检查

使用隔离和可见性控制单独检查每个材质

记录发现

截取隔离材质的屏幕截图用于文档记录或报告

质量控制流程

  1. 材质一致性: 检查应统一的相似材质
  2. 透明度问题: 识别不需要的透明材质
  3. 颜色准确性: 验证材质颜色是否符合设计规范
  4. 使用分析: 检查哪些组件使用特定材质

高级技巧

搜索策略

  • 基于颜色的命名: 搜索"red"、"blue"、"metal"等
  • 组件搜索: 查找"housing"、"bracket"、"cover"等
  • 属性搜索: 查找"transparent"、"chrome"、"plastic"等

分析技术

  • 隔离工作流程: 系统性地隔离每个材质
  • 比较方法: 在材质间切换以比较属性
  • 截图记录: 捕获材质特定的视图
  • 属性验证: 与 CAD 规范进行交叉检查

移动端最佳实践

  • 横向方向: 更适合详细材质分析
  • 双手操作: 一只手握设备,另一只手交互
  • 充足照明: 确保色彩精度的屏幕可见性
  • 稳定定位: 长时间分析使用设备支架

专业工作流程: 使用隔离 → 分析 → 截图 → 记录序列进行系统性材质审查。

故障排除

常见问题

未找到材质

  • 原因: 模型可能没有材质定义
  • 解决方案: 检查原始 CAD 文件的材质分配
  • 替代方案: 材质可能嵌入在网格几何体中

材质面板无法打开

  • 要求: 必须处于全屏模式
  • 解决方案: 先点击全屏图标 (⛶),然后访问材质
  • 移动端: 使用 More 菜单 (⋯) 访问材质面板

材质过多时性能缓慢

  • 优化: 使用搜索过滤材质
  • 移动端提示: 关闭其他浏览器标签以释放内存
  • 大型模型: 考虑在 CAD 软件中简化材质

颜色显示问题

  • 颜色准确性: 检查显示器颜色校准
  • 透明度: 某些材质在特定照明下可能显示为不透明
  • 浏览器支持: 确保 WebGL 2.0 已正确启用

性能优化

获得更好性能

  • 关闭未使用的面板: 仅保持必要界面开启
  • 限制隔离: 避免同时隔离过多材质
  • 使用搜索: 过滤材质而非滚动浏览长列表
  • 移动端内存: 材质分析前关闭后台应用

与其他功能的集成

测量工具

  • 为确保准确性,测量前隔离材质
  • 使用材质颜色区分测量点
  • 结合截图进行材质特定文档记录

视图控制

  • 将材质隔离与预设视图结合用于标准文档记录
  • 结合正交投影和材质分析进行技术制图
  • 检查材质属性时在透视和正交投影间切换

导出功能

  • 材质在兼容的导出格式(OBJ+MTL、glTF)中得以保留
  • 材质属性传输到支持的格式
  • 使用材质分析验证导出准确性

准备好掌握 3D 模型中的材质管理了吗?开始加载包含多个材质的模型,探索综合的材质分析工具吧!